Product Development Foundations, Instructor's Note

By: Marco Iansiti
  • Format:Print
  • | Pages:46
ShareBar

Abstract

As emphasized in the course overview, excellence in product development is built on three foundations: the activities aimed at generating, retaining, and integrating knowledge. They form the critical building blocks for the conceptualization and implementation of any new product. The module--and this note--focus on each of these foundations in detail and introduce a variety of methodologies and approaches. The six classroom sessions draw upon cases, conceptual notes, interactive lectures, and an exercise. The note shows how these are linked together, to subsequent module themes and materials, and to student project activities.
